Today, I would like to share advice from a Millionaire to Millennials: Buy a Home Now!
In a CNBC article, self-made millionaire David Bach said “the single biggest mistake millennials are making” is not buying a home as buying real estate is “an escalator to wealth.”
Bach went on to explain:
“If millennials don’t buy a home, their chances of actually having any wealth in this country are little to none. The average homeowner to this day is 38 times wealthier than a renter.”
In his bestselling book, The Automatic Millionaire, Bach does the math:
“As a renter, you can easily spend half a million dollars or more on rent over the years ($1,500 a month for 30 years comes to $540,000), and in the end wind up just where you started – owning nothing. Or you can buy a house and spend the same amount paying down a mortgage, and in the end wind up owning your own home free and clear!”
Who is David Bach?
Bach is a self-made millionaire who has written 9 consecutive New York Times bestsellers. His book, The Automatic Millionaire,” was on the NYT’s bestseller list for 31 weeks. He has had 4 books simultaneously on the New York Times, Wall Street Journal, BusinessWeek and USA Today bestseller lists.
David Bach has been a contributor to NBC’s Today Show, appearing more than 100 times. He is also a regular on ABC, CBS, Fox, CNBC, CNN, Yahoo, The View, and PBS.
